/external/chromium_org/third_party/skia/gm/ |
complexclip.cpp | 89 SkRegion::Op fOp; 92 {SkRegion::kIntersect_Op, "Isect "}, 93 {SkRegion::kDifference_Op, "Diff " }, 94 {SkRegion::kUnion_Op, "Union "}, 95 {SkRegion::kXOR_Op, "Xor " }, 96 {SkRegion::kReverseDifference_Op, "RDiff "} 133 canvas->clipPath(clipA, SkRegion::kIntersect_Op, fDoAAClip);
|
megalooper.cpp | 94 canvas->clipRect(outerClip, SkRegion::kIntersect_Op); 95 canvas->clipRect(innerClip, SkRegion::kDifference_Op); 149 canvas->clipRect(outerClip, SkRegion::kIntersect_Op); 150 canvas->clipRect(rect, SkRegion::kDifference_Op); 199 canvas->clipRect(outerClip, SkRegion::kIntersect_Op); 200 canvas->clipRect(rect, SkRegion::kDifference_Op);
|
/external/skia/bench/ |
AAClipBench.cpp | 13 #include "SkRegion.h" 62 canvas->clipPath(fClipPath, SkRegion::kReplace_Op, fDoAA); 64 canvas->clipRect(fClipRect, SkRegion::kReplace_Op, fDoAA); 133 0 == depth ? SkRegion::kReplace_Op : 134 SkRegion::kIntersect_Op, 178 SkRegion fRegion; 228 fRegion.setPath(path, SkRegion(bounds)); 241 SkRegion fRegion;
|
/external/skia/gm/ |
complexclip.cpp | 89 SkRegion::Op fOp; 92 {SkRegion::kIntersect_Op, "Isect "}, 93 {SkRegion::kDifference_Op, "Diff " }, 94 {SkRegion::kUnion_Op, "Union "}, 95 {SkRegion::kXOR_Op, "Xor " }, 96 {SkRegion::kReverseDifference_Op, "RDiff "} 133 canvas->clipPath(clipA, SkRegion::kIntersect_Op, fDoAAClip);
|
megalooper.cpp | 94 canvas->clipRect(outerClip, SkRegion::kIntersect_Op); 95 canvas->clipRect(innerClip, SkRegion::kDifference_Op); 149 canvas->clipRect(outerClip, SkRegion::kIntersect_Op); 150 canvas->clipRect(rect, SkRegion::kDifference_Op); 199 canvas->clipRect(outerClip, SkRegion::kIntersect_Op); 200 canvas->clipRect(rect, SkRegion::kDifference_Op);
|
/frameworks/base/libs/hwui/ |
StatefulBaseRenderer.cpp | 153 bool StatefulBaseRenderer::clipRect(float left, float top, float right, float bottom, SkRegion::Op op) { 165 bool StatefulBaseRenderer::clipPath(const SkPath* path, SkRegion::Op op) { 172 SkRegion clip; 184 SkRegion region; 192 bool StatefulBaseRenderer::clipRegion(const SkRegion* region, SkRegion::Op op) { 205 clipRect(bounds.left, bounds.top, bounds.right, bounds.bottom, SkRegion::kIntersect_Op);
|
/external/chromium_org/skia/ext/ |
analysis_canvas.h | 80 SkRegion::Op op, 83 SkRegion::Op op, 86 SkRegion::Op op,
|
/external/chromium_org/third_party/WebKit/Source/platform/graphics/skia/ |
SkiaUtils.h | 49 class SkRegion;
|
/external/chromium_org/third_party/skia/tests/ |
DeviceLooperTest.cpp | 75 static void make_rgn(SkRegion* rgn, int w, int h, unsigned mask) { 88 rgn->op(r, SkRegion::kUnion_Op); 122 SkRegion rgn; 126 rc.op(rgn, SkRegion::kReplace_Op);
|
CanvasStateTest.cpp | 115 SkRegion clipRegion; 117 clipRegion.op(regionInterior, SkRegion::kDifference_Op); 120 const SkRegion::Op clipOps[] = { SkRegion::kIntersect_Op, 121 SkRegion::kIntersect_Op, 122 SkRegion::kReplace_Op, 139 SkRegion localRegion = clipRegion; 223 canvas.clipRRect(roundRect, SkRegion::kIntersect_Op, true);
|
/external/skia/tests/ |
DeviceLooperTest.cpp | 75 static void make_rgn(SkRegion* rgn, int w, int h, unsigned mask) { 88 rgn->op(r, SkRegion::kUnion_Op); 122 SkRegion rgn; 126 rc.op(rgn, SkRegion::kReplace_Op);
|
CanvasStateTest.cpp | 115 SkRegion clipRegion; 117 clipRegion.op(regionInterior, SkRegion::kDifference_Op); 120 const SkRegion::Op clipOps[] = { SkRegion::kIntersect_Op, 121 SkRegion::kIntersect_Op, 122 SkRegion::kReplace_Op, 139 SkRegion localRegion = clipRegion; 223 canvas.clipRRect(roundRect, SkRegion::kIntersect_Op, true);
|
/frameworks/base/include/private/graphics/ |
Canvas.h | 78 virtual bool clipRect(float left, float top, float right, float bottom, SkRegion::Op op) = 0; 79 virtual bool clipPath(const SkPath* path, SkRegion::Op op) = 0; 80 virtual bool clipRegion(const SkRegion* region, SkRegion::Op op) = 0;
|
/external/chromium_org/ui/gfx/ |
path_win.cc | 9 #include "third_party/skia/include/core/SkRegion.h" 14 HRGN CreateHRGNFromSkRegion(const SkRegion& region) { 18 for (SkRegion::Iterator i(region); !i.done(); i.next()) {
|
/external/chromium_org/third_party/skia/include/pdf/ |
SkPDFDevice.h | 222 SkRegion fExistingClipRegion; 252 const SkRegion& existingClipRegion); 264 const SkRegion& clipRegion, 273 const SkRegion& clipRegion, 285 const SkRegion& clipRegion, 299 const SkRegion& clipRegion,
|
/external/chromium_org/third_party/skia/samplecode/ |
SampleComplexClip.cpp | 83 SkRegion::Op fOp; 86 {SkRegion::kIntersect_Op, "Isect "}, 87 {SkRegion::kDifference_Op, "Diff " }, 88 {SkRegion::kUnion_Op, "Union "}, 89 {SkRegion::kXOR_Op, "Xor " }, 90 {SkRegion::kReverseDifference_Op, "RDiff "}
|
/external/chromium_org/third_party/skia/src/utils/debugger/ |
SkDebugCanvas.h | 253 virtual void onClipRect(const SkRect&, SkRegion::Op, ClipEdgeStyle) SK_OVERRIDE; 254 virtual void onClipRRect(const SkRRect&, SkRegion::Op, ClipEdgeStyle) SK_OVERRIDE; 255 virtual void onClipPath(const SkPath&, SkRegion::Op, ClipEdgeStyle) SK_OVERRIDE; 256 virtual void onClipRegion(const SkRegion& region, SkRegion::Op) SK_OVERRIDE; 325 void addClipStackData(const SkPath& devPath, const SkPath& operand, SkRegion::Op elementOp);
|
/external/skia/include/pdf/ |
SkPDFDevice.h | 222 SkRegion fExistingClipRegion; 252 const SkRegion& existingClipRegion); 264 const SkRegion& clipRegion, 273 const SkRegion& clipRegion, 285 const SkRegion& clipRegion, 299 const SkRegion& clipRegion,
|
/external/skia/samplecode/ |
SampleComplexClip.cpp | 83 SkRegion::Op fOp; 86 {SkRegion::kIntersect_Op, "Isect "}, 87 {SkRegion::kDifference_Op, "Diff " }, 88 {SkRegion::kUnion_Op, "Union "}, 89 {SkRegion::kXOR_Op, "Xor " }, 90 {SkRegion::kReverseDifference_Op, "RDiff "}
|
/external/skia/src/utils/debugger/ |
SkDebugCanvas.h | 253 virtual void onClipRect(const SkRect&, SkRegion::Op, ClipEdgeStyle) SK_OVERRIDE; 254 virtual void onClipRRect(const SkRRect&, SkRegion::Op, ClipEdgeStyle) SK_OVERRIDE; 255 virtual void onClipPath(const SkPath&, SkRegion::Op, ClipEdgeStyle) SK_OVERRIDE; 256 virtual void onClipRegion(const SkRegion& region, SkRegion::Op) SK_OVERRIDE; 325 void addClipStackData(const SkPath& devPath, const SkPath& operand, SkRegion::Op elementOp);
|
/external/chromium_org/third_party/skia/src/gpu/ |
GrClipMaskManager.cpp | 130 SkRegion::Op op = iter.get()->getOp(); 134 case SkRegion::kReplace_Op: 137 case SkRegion::kIntersect_Op: 143 case SkRegion::kDifference_Op: 357 void setup_boolean_blendcoeffs(GrDrawState* drawState, SkRegion::Op op) { 360 case SkRegion::kReplace_Op: 363 case SkRegion::kIntersect_Op: 366 case SkRegion::kUnion_Op: 369 case SkRegion::kXOR_Op: 372 case SkRegion::kDifference_Op [all...] |
/external/skia/src/gpu/ |
GrClipMaskManager.cpp | 130 SkRegion::Op op = iter.get()->getOp(); 134 case SkRegion::kReplace_Op: 137 case SkRegion::kIntersect_Op: 143 case SkRegion::kDifference_Op: 357 void setup_boolean_blendcoeffs(GrDrawState* drawState, SkRegion::Op op) { 360 case SkRegion::kReplace_Op: 363 case SkRegion::kIntersect_Op: 366 case SkRegion::kUnion_Op: 369 case SkRegion::kXOR_Op: 372 case SkRegion::kDifference_Op [all...] |
/external/chromium_org/third_party/skia/src/utils/ |
SkCanvasStateUtils.cpp | 139 virtual void clipRect(const SkRect& rect, SkRegion::Op op, bool antialias) SK_OVERRIDE { 143 virtual void clipRRect(const SkRRect& rrect, SkRegion::Op op, bool antialias) SK_OVERRIDE { 147 virtual void clipPath(const SkPath&, SkRegion::Op, bool antialias) SK_OVERRIDE { 155 static void setup_MC_state(SkMCState* state, const SkMatrix& matrix, const SkRegion& clip) { 176 SkRegion::Iterator clip_iterator(clip); 276 SkRegion clip; 282 SkRegion::kUnion_Op);
|
/external/skia/src/utils/ |
SkCanvasStateUtils.cpp | 139 virtual void clipRect(const SkRect& rect, SkRegion::Op op, bool antialias) SK_OVERRIDE { 143 virtual void clipRRect(const SkRRect& rrect, SkRegion::Op op, bool antialias) SK_OVERRIDE { 147 virtual void clipPath(const SkPath&, SkRegion::Op, bool antialias) SK_OVERRIDE { 155 static void setup_MC_state(SkMCState* state, const SkMatrix& matrix, const SkRegion& clip) { 176 SkRegion::Iterator clip_iterator(clip); 276 SkRegion clip; 282 SkRegion::kUnion_Op);
|
/external/chromium_org/third_party/WebKit/Source/platform/graphics/ |
GraphicsContext.h | 310 void clipRoundedRect(const RoundedRect&, SkRegion::Op = SkRegion::kIntersect_Op); 311 void clipOut(const IntRect& rect) { clipRect(rect, NotAntiAliased, SkRegion::kDifference_Op); } 315 void clipRect(const SkRect&, AntiAliasingMode = NotAntiAliased, SkRegion::Op = SkRegion::kIntersect_Op); 435 void clipPath(const SkPath&, AntiAliasingMode = NotAntiAliased, SkRegion::Op = SkRegion::kIntersect_Op); 436 void clipRRect(const SkRRect&, AntiAliasingMode = NotAntiAliased, SkRegion::Op = SkRegion::kIntersect_Op);
|